Cement replacement services involve removing deteriorated or damaged sections of concrete and installing fresh material in their place. This process typically includes carefully breaking out compromised concrete, preparing the underlying surface, and pouring new concrete that matches the existing structure. The goal is to restore the strength, stability, and appearance of the concrete surface, ensuring it can continue to support daily use without issues. These services are often performed on driveways, sidewalks, patios, and foundation slabs to address areas that have become cracked, spalled, or otherwise compromised over time.
This service is especially helpful for solving problems caused by concrete deterioration, such as cracking, uneven surfaces, or sections that have crumbled or fallen away. Over time, exposure to weather, ground movement, or heavy loads can cause concrete to weaken, leading to safety hazards or further damage if not addressed. Cement replacement can also improve the overall look of a property by fixing unsightly cracks or stains, helping to maintain curb appeal and structural integrity. Recognizing when cement replacement is needed can help prevent more costly repairs down the line. Signs that indicate a property might require this service include large cracks, uneven surfaces, or sections of concrete that are sinking or crumbling. If concrete surfaces are no longer level or have become hazardous to walk or drive on, consulting with local service providers for an assessment can be a practical step. These professionals can determine whether patching, resurfacing, or full replacement is the best solution to restore safety, functionality, and appearance to the property.
The overview below groups typical Cement Replacement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Greenfield,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cement replacement projects in Greenfield, IN range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this band, covering small patches or surface-level fixes. Larger or more complex repairs may exceed this range.
Moderate Projects - Medium-sized cement replacement services generally cost between $600 and $2,000. These projects often involve replacing larger sections or resurfacing areas, which are common for residential driveways and walkways.
Full Replacement - Complete replacement of a concrete slab or structure can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Larger, more intricate projects, such as commercial spaces or extensive driveways, tend to fall into this higher cost bracket.
Complex or Custom Jobs - Larger, more complex cement replacement projects can reach $5,000+ depending on scope and materials. These are less common and typically involve specialized work or custom designs handled by local contractors in Greenfield, IN.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
